We preview Sunday’s European Rugby Champions Cup game between the Scarlets and Saracens.

Saracens are runaway leaders of Pool 3, having won all four of their matches. They may, however, find the going tough against a Scarlets side looking to reel in Toulon and claim second position when the Londoners visit the Parc y Scarlets on Sunday.

Scarlets
In what is turning out to be a potentially promising season for the Welsh outfit, the Scarlets currently sit in fifth position on th Pro12 standing (just one point off of fourth-placed Glasgow) and could heap more pressure on former champions Toulon to qualify, with a win at home this weekend. With two wins on the bounce coming into this match (and four from their last six in all competitions), the men in red will be quietly confident going against the Saracens juggernaut.

With several classy players in their ranks such as Liam Williams, Garett Davies, D.T.H van der Merwe and Jonathan Davies, the Scarlets’ backline will always have a degree of X-Factor about it. Their forwards however, lack the talent promise of their backs, and they run the risk of being targeted by Saracens on match day.

Saracens
Sarries meanwhile, have ascended to first place in Pool 3 and are eight points above nearest challengers Toulon. With their progression to the knockout phase secure, the Londoners may decide to pick an understrength side to do battle this weekend. Last weekend’s comeback draw against Exeter ended a four-match winning streak, and they will be hurting after the disappointing result at home.

Whatever Saracens team is picked this week, expect them to come out all guns blazing, and to show their hosts little mercy. The Londoners will want to keep their unbeaten record in the competition intact (indeed, the last time they lost a game amongst European rugby’s elite was way back in the 2014/15 season), and will go hard in at their Welsh counterparts.
